About Skagway Tours

Skagway Tours operates guided sightseeing and specialty excursions based in Skagway, Alaska, offering a spectrum of day trips into Alaska and the Yukon. The company runs scenic drives along the historic Klondike Highway to White Pass Summit and into the Yukon, including stops at waterfalls, glaciers, wildflower valleys, and the Yukon Suspension Bridge. Several itineraries focus on sled dog experiences, with visits to Tutshi Sled Dog Camp to meet husky puppies, ride dog carts in summer, and learn from professional mushers and trainers. Private tour options provide customizable timeframes and focused itineraries for travelers seeking tailored photography, wildlife viewing, or Gold Rush history interpretation. Tours that cross into Canada note passport requirements where applicable.

Skagway Tours emphasizes expert local narration about the Klondike Gold Rush, regional geography, and natural history. Vehicles travel the same historic routes used during gold rush migrations, combining accessible overlooks with short, narrated stops. Guests can expect multiple photo opportunities at the White Pass Summit, glacier viewpoints, and river crossings, as well as family-friendly activities such as puppy meet-and-greets. The company’s offerings include winter and summer departures, suspension bridge access, and combo itineraries that pair summit views with sled dog interactions. Safety practices, on-site handlers at dog camps, and guided crossings of elevated walkways like the Yukon Suspension Bridge are integrated into tour operations. Whether seeking a short city and summit excursion, an extended Yukon adventure, or a private guided route, Skagway Tours provides a range of locally based experiences that showcase Alaska and Yukon landscapes.
